Chandra/HETGS Spectroscopy of the Anomalous X-ray Pulsar 4U 0142+61

We report on a 25 ks Chandra/HETGS observation of the 8.7 s anomalous X-ray pulsar 4U 0142+61. The continuum spectrum is consistent with previous measurements and is well fit by an absorbed power-law + blackbody. The pulsed fraction was between 8.7% and 21%, also consistent with past measurements. No evidence was found for emission or absorption lines, with an upper limit of 50 eV on the equivalent width of broad features in the 2.5--13 Å (0.95--5.0 keV) range and an upper limit of 10 eV on the equivalent width of narrow features in the 4.1--17.7 Å (0.7--3.0 keV) range. If the source is a magnetar, then the absence of a proton cyclotron line strongly constrains magnetar atmosphere models and hence the magnetic field strength of the neutron star. For the energy range given above, the disallowed magnetic field strengths of 4U 0142+61 are (1.9--9.8)× 10^14 G. This is still consistent with the dipole field strength of B=1.3× 10^14 G (at the polar cap) estimated from the pulsar's spindown. We will also present the results of pulse-phase-resolved spectroscopy of these data.
